好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

深度学习在手机故障诊断-全面剖析.pptx

35页
  • 卖家[上传人]:布***
  • 文档编号:599056876
  • 上传时间:2025-02-28
  • 文档格式:PPTX
  • 文档大小:166.92KB
  • / 35 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 深度学习在故障诊断,故障诊断背景与挑战 深度学习原理介绍 故障数据预处理 神经网络架构选择与应用 故障特征提取与分析 模型训练与参数优化 诊断结果验证与评估 深度学习在故障诊断的展望,Contents Page,目录页,故障诊断背景与挑战,深度学习在故障诊断,故障诊断背景与挑战,故障诊断技术的发展历程,1.从传统的故障诊断方法发展到现代的自动化和智能化诊断技术,故障诊断技术经历了从人工经验到自动化工具,再到人工智能的演进过程2.随着信息技术的飞速发展,数据采集和处理能力的显著提升,深度学习等人工智能技术在故障诊断领域的应用日益广泛3.诊断技术的不断进步,使得故障诊断的速度和准确性得到显著提高,为工业生产、交通运输等领域提供了强有力的技术支持故障诊断的背景,1.随着等电子产品的普及,故障诊断成为维护用户利益、保证产品使用安全的重要环节2.随着产品复杂度的提高,传统故障诊断技术的局限性日益凸显,对新型诊断技术的需求愈发迫切3.故障诊断的背景还包括对用户体验的重视,快速响应市场变化,提高产品竞争力等方面故障诊断背景与挑战,故障诊断的挑战,1.等电子产品的多样化、复杂化,导致故障现象难以捕捉和识别,增加了故障诊断的难度。

      2.故障数据的不完整性和噪声处理问题,使得故障诊断算法的准确性和可靠性受到影响3.维护成本和人力成本的限制,要求故障诊断技术具有高度自动化和智能化,以提高工作效率深度学习在故障诊断中的应用,1.深度学习具有强大的特征提取和学习能力,能够从海量数据中挖掘故障特征,提高诊断准确率2.深度学习模型可以自适应地调整参数,具有较强的泛化能力,适用于不同类型的故障诊断任务3.随着计算能力的提升,深度学习在故障诊断领域的应用越来越广泛,有助于推动故障诊断技术的进一步发展故障诊断背景与挑战,1.随着用户对产品使用体验的要求不断提高,故障诊断的实时性成为衡量诊断技术优劣的重要指标2.深度学习等人工智能技术在故障诊断中的应用,使得诊断速度和效率得到显著提升3.实时高效的故障诊断技术有助于缩短维修周期,降低企业运营成本,提高用户体验故障诊断的跨学科融合,1.故障诊断领域涉及多个学科,如电子工程、计算机科学、数学等,跨学科融合有助于推动故障诊断技术的发展2.在故障诊断过程中,充分发挥不同学科的优势,可以优化诊断算法,提高诊断效果3.跨学科融合有助于形成具有创新性的故障诊断理论体系,为相关领域的研究提供新的思路。

      故障诊断的实时性与效率,深度学习原理介绍,深度学习在故障诊断,深度学习原理介绍,深度学习的起源与发展,1.深度学习起源于20世纪50年代,经过多个阶段的发展,特别是2006年Hinton等人的研究推动了深度学习的复兴2.发展趋势表明,深度学习在图像识别、自然语言处理等领域取得了显著的进展,已成为人工智能领域的重要研究方向3.当前深度学习的研究前沿涉及神经架构搜索、图神经网络、可解释性研究等,不断推动技术的创新和应用深度学习的基本原理,1.深度学习基于人工神经网络,通过多层非线性变换模拟人脑处理信息的过程2.主要原理包括前向传播和反向传播,前者用于计算网络输出,后者用于根据误差调整网络权重3.深度学习模型通过不断迭代优化,能够从大量数据中自动学习特征和模式深度学习原理介绍,神经网络架构,1.神经网络架构包括输入层、隐藏层和输出层,不同层数和层内节点数量的选择对模型性能有重要影响2.深度卷积神经网络(CNN)在图像识别领域取得了成功,循环神经网络(RNN)在序列数据处理中表现出色3.近年来,新型神经网络架构如Transformer在自然语言处理任务中展现出强大的能力激活函数和优化算法,1.激活函数如ReLU、Sigmoid和Tanh等,用于引入非线性,使神经网络能够学习更复杂的特征。

      2.优化算法如梯度下降、Adam等,用于调整网络权重,以最小化预测误差3.前沿研究包括自适应学习率和正则化技术,以提高模型泛化能力和减少过拟合深度学习原理介绍,深度学习的应用领域,1.深度学习在图像识别、语音识别、自然语言处理等领域取得了突破性进展,广泛应用于实际应用中2.在医疗领域,深度学习可用于辅助诊断、疾病预测和病理分析等3.工业领域,深度学习可应用于设备故障诊断、产品质量检测等,提高生产效率和安全性深度学习的挑战与展望,1.深度学习模型通常需要大量数据和计算资源,且难以解释其决策过程,存在隐私和伦理问题2.未来研究需要解决模型可解释性、数据隐私保护等问题,同时提高模型在资源受限环境下的性能3.随着量子计算、边缘计算等技术的发展,深度学习有望在更多领域得到应用和拓展故障数据预处理,深度学习在故障诊断,故障数据预处理,数据收集与采集,1.数据来源多样化:故障数据可以从售后服务记录、用户反馈、市场调查等多渠道收集,确保数据的全面性和代表性2.数据质量保证:在数据采集过程中,需对数据进行初步筛选,剔除无效、重复或异常数据,保障后续处理和分析的准确性3.技术进步驱动:随着物联网和大数据技术的发展,故障数据的采集手段不断丰富,如使用传感器技术实时监测状态,为故障诊断提供更多数据支持。

      数据清洗与预处理,1.缺失值处理:针对采集过程中可能出现的缺失数据,采用多种算法如均值填充、中位数填充或插值法进行处理,确保数据的完整性2.异常值检测与处理:运用统计方法和可视化技术识别异常值,并通过删除、修正或替换等方法进行处理,避免异常值对模型性能的影响3.数据标准化:为了消除不同特征之间的量纲差异,采用标准化或归一化方法对数据进行预处理,使模型训练更为稳定故障数据预处理,特征工程,1.特征提取:通过对原始数据的分析,提取反映故障特征的关键指标,如电池温度、运行时间、使用频率等,为模型提供有力支撑2.特征选择:运用特征选择算法,如互信息、卡方检验等,筛选出对故障诊断贡献度高的特征,减少冗余信息,提高模型效率3.特征组合:结合领域知识,通过特征组合生成新的特征,如将电池使用时间与使用环境温度组合,以获取更多故障信息数据增强,1.数据扩展:通过旋转、缩放、裁剪等图像处理技术对数据集进行扩展,增加数据的多样性,提高模型的泛化能力2.生成对抗网络(GANs):利用生成对抗网络生成新的故障样本,扩充训练数据集,增强模型的鲁棒性3.跨域数据融合:将不同品牌、型号的故障数据进行融合,拓宽模型的应用范围,提高诊断准确性。

      故障数据预处理,1.随机划分:采用随机抽样方法将数据集划分为训练集、验证集和测试集,确保每个集的代表性,避免人为干预导致的偏差2.交叉验证:运用交叉验证技术对模型进行评估,提高模型评估的可靠性3.数据集大小:根据实际情况确定数据集的大小,既要保证模型有足够的样本进行训练,又要避免数据集过大导致模型过拟合模型训练与优化,1.模型选择:根据故障诊断任务的特点,选择合适的深度学习模型,如卷积神经网络(CNNs)、循环神经网络(RNNs)等2.超参数调整:通过不断调整模型超参数,如学习率、批次大小等,优化模型性能3.模型集成:采用集成学习方法,如Boosting、Bagging等,提高模型预测的准确性和稳定性数据集划分,神经网络架构选择与应用,深度学习在故障诊断,神经网络架构选择与应用,神经网络架构选择原则,1.适应性:选择的神经网络架构应具备良好的适应能力,能够处理多样化的故障数据和故障模式2.泛化能力:所选架构需具备较强的泛化能力,即能够应用于不同的故障诊断场景和设备类型3.计算效率:在保证准确度的前提下,应考虑神经网络的计算复杂度,实现高效的处理速度常用神经网络架构介绍,1.卷积神经网络(CNN):适用于图像处理和特征提取,对于屏幕故障、摄像头问题等视觉相关故障诊断效果显著。

      2.循环神经网络(RNN):擅长处理序列数据,对于使用过程中的日志序列分析,如电池寿命预测等,有较好的应用3.长短期记忆网络(LSTM):作为RNN的一种,LSTM通过门控机制可以有效处理长序列依赖问题,适用于故障诊断中的长期趋势分析神经网络架构选择与应用,深度学习在故障特征提取中的应用,1.自编码器:通过自编码器进行特征学习,可以自动提取故障数据中的有效特征,减少人工干预2.特征融合:结合多种特征提取方法,如CNN和RNN的结合,可以提高故障特征提取的全面性和准确性3.降噪处理:利用深度学习模型对噪声数据进行预处理,提高故障诊断的鲁棒性神经网络架构优化策略,1.模型剪枝:通过剪枝技术去除神经网络中不必要的连接,减少模型复杂度,提高运行效率2.超参数调整:针对不同故障诊断任务,优化网络中的超参数,如学习率、批量大小等,以提高模型性能3.正则化技术:应用L1、L2正则化等方法,防止模型过拟合,提高泛化能力神经网络架构选择与应用,1.电池故障诊断:通过分析电池使用过程中的电流、电压等数据,利用深度学习模型预测电池寿命,实现提前预警2.软件故障诊断:分析软件运行日志,利用神经网络模型识别软件错误和异常行为,提高软件稳定性。

      3.硬件故障诊断:结合硬件传感器数据,构建深度学习模型,实现对硬件故障的实时监测和诊断未来神经网络架构的发展趋势,1.神经架构搜索(NAS):通过自动搜索最优神经网络结构,有望提高模型性能和减少设计时间2.迁移学习:将预训练模型应用于新的故障诊断任务,提高模型的快速适应能力和泛化能力3.多模态学习:结合不同类型的数据(如文本、图像、传感器数据),构建更加全面的故障诊断模型神经网络在故障诊断中的实际应用案例,故障特征提取与分析,深度学习在故障诊断,故障特征提取与分析,故障特征提取方法,1.数据采集:通过传感器、日志分析等手段收集故障数据,包括硬件参数、软件状态、用户行为等2.特征选择:运用特征选择算法,从原始数据中筛选出与故障诊断高度相关的特征,减少冗余信息3.特征提取:采用深度学习模型,如卷积神经网络(CNN)、循环神经网络(RNN)等,对特征进行自动提取和提取层次化特征深度学习模型在故障特征提取中的应用,1.模型选择:根据故障数据的性质选择合适的深度学习模型,如CNN用于图像识别,RNN用于序列数据处理2.模型训练:利用大量标记好的故障数据对模型进行训练,使模型能够学习到故障特征与故障类型之间的映射关系。

      3.模型优化:通过调整模型结构和参数,提高故障特征的提取效果和诊断准确率故障特征提取与分析,1.故障分类:根据故障特征将故障划分为不同的类别,如硬件故障、软件故障、用户操作错误等2.故障趋势预测:通过分析故障特征的趋势,预测未来的故障类型和发生概率3.故障原因分析:结合故障特征和已有的故障知识库,分析故障产生的原因,为故障修复提供依据多源数据的融合与处理,1.数据融合:将来自不同来源的故障数据进行整合,如硬件日志、软件日志、用户反馈等,以获得更全面的故障信息2.异构数据处理:针对不同类型的数据,采用不同的处理方法,如文本数据使用自然语言处理技术,图像数据使用图像识别技术3.融合策略优化:通过实验和数据分析,优化数据融合策略,提高故障诊断的准确性和效率故障特征分析与故障诊断,故障特征提取与分析,故障特征的可解释性,1.特征重要性分析:利用模型内部的权重信息,分析各个故障特征的重要性,为故障诊断提供依据2.解释性模型构建:构建可解释的深度学习模型,如注意力机制模型,使模型决策过程更加透明3.故障原因可视化:将故障特征和故障原因以可视化的形式呈现,帮助用户更好地理解故障发生的机理故障特征提取与分析中的挑战与展望,1.数据质量:提高数据质量,减少噪声和不准确信息,是故障特征提取和分析的关键。

      2.模型泛化能力:增强模型的泛化能力,使其能够适应不同类型和品牌的故障。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.